Star Wars: The Mandalorian (Disney+)

Premiere Date: November 12th, 2019

Synopsis: After the stories of Jango and Boba Fett, another warrior emerges in the Star Wars universe. The Mandalorian is set after the fall of the Empire and before the emergence of the First Order. We follow the travails of a lone gunfighter in the outer reaches of the galaxy far from the authority of the New Republic.

Starring: Pedro Pascal, Giancarlo Esposito, Gina Carano, Emily Swallow, Carl Weathers, Nick Nolte, Omid Abtahi, Taika Waititi, Ming-Na Wen, Werner Herzog, Bill Burr and Mark Boone Junior.

Showrunner: Jon Favreau

Trailer #1: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=aOC8E8z_ifw
Trailer #2: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=XmI7WKrAtqs


SEASON 1
Code:
EPISODE | RELEASE DATE | DIRECTOR

EP 101 | TUE NOV 12 | Dave Filoni 
EP 102 | FRI NOV 15 | Rick Famuyiwa 
EP 103 | FRI NOV 22 | Deborah Chow 
EP 104 | FRI NOV 29 | Bryce Dallas Howard 
EP 105 | FRI DEC 06 | Dave Filoni 
EP 106 | FRI DEC 13 | Rick Famuyiwa 
EP 107 | WED DEC 18 | Deborah Chow
EP 108 | FRI DEC 27 | Taika Waititi

    I sort of think it might make more sense from a business perspective and creating longer-lasting buzz about a show. I feel like when a show releases on Netflix, it gets a moment of buzz and then sort of goes radio silent. Some break through and become hits like Stranger Things, but I feel like soo much of their content comes and goes without anybody noticing it.

    When you release episode by episode, and there are reviews out there of each episode, it sort of maintains a longer presence in the news cycle, and can attract new viewers/subscribers. I get that some of our habits are formed to want to binge, but I would guess there's a business advantage to the weekly schedule.

    Although in this instance, I don't know how much prolonged media exposure a Star Wars series necessarily needs to gain more viewers, but in general I think it makes sense with content at such a high right now.
